Love on the Rock…
When Chloe Winters answers an advertisement seeking a private tutor for a six-year-old girl, little does she know it means relocating from metropolitan Boston to an isolated mansion on a cliff overlooking the Atlantic Ocean in Newfoundland. Nor does she realize the little girl's widower father is Gaelan Byrne, a billionaire alpha-male type whose brooding good looks have brought him as much fame as his wealth. But Chloe, shocked by his coldness toward his daughter, vows to remain unmoved by both his fortune and his charisma.
Gaelan Byrne has been dragged to hell and back by women before and is none too happy to discover the matronly retired teacher he hoped to hire turns out to be the beautiful, caring Chloe. But how can he fire her when the daughter he is incapable of loving adores her?
Chloe and Gaelan edge toward one another, and the attraction they feel soon engulfs them with all the intensity of a spring storm. But the secrets Gaelan keeps makes any chance for happiness seem as remote as the windswept cliffs of Newfoundland.
Reminiscent of Charlotte Bronte's Jane Eyre, The Billionaire’ s Secrets combines classic contemporary romance in the tradition of Kristin Hannah and Nora Roberts with the dramatic Gothic landscape of Atlantic Canada, showing us the true meaning of strength, loss, and what it means to risk everything to find, and keep, true love.

Is this guy considered "Alpha" or just plain rude?
By Inspiring Insomnia
I thought the book description of billionaire Gaelan's coldness towards his six year old daughter and his inability to feel love for her must have been exaggerated. But then I read the book, and it is quite accurate. Not only that, but he keeps her virtually imprisoned in their house, home schooled and not allowed to have friends visit. The description did not mention his rudeness and arrogance, which he possesses in abundance.
He hires Chloe sight unseen to be his daughter's in-home tutor. Upon meeting her, he immediately fires her and declares, "I don't have to explain myself to you. I've met you, and I don't want you here. End of story." So what was Chloe's transgression? She's too young and too pretty; he had thought he was hiring a grandmotherly type. Shortly after, he hires her back, then practically attacks her with a kiss, and then SHE threatens to quit. She doesn't, of course, and the reason provided is that she feels such a strong bond with the child she had met mere hours before.
They spat and spar as they gradually learn to trust each other, and Chloe learns the reason for Gaelan's attitude towards his daughter. It is quite dramatic, as expected, but it's an absurd excuse for mistreatment of a young child. We know how the book will end, because we've seen it all: walls will come down, misunderstandings will be understood, obstacles will be obliterated, etc.
*** Note- contains some spoliers***
About 1/3 of the way through the book, Gaelan begins his transition to Completely Different Person and decides that he's in love with Chloe and that it might be a good idea to stop forcing his daughter to address him by his first name.
Soon after, Sophia and Chloe are in a car crash. Chloe is fine, but little Sophia is hospitalized with a concussion. When Gaelan learns of the crash, he seems more concerned over Chloe's welfare than his daughter's. I guess this is supposed to be romantic. Rather grossly, Gaelan's and Chloe's first romantic encounter occurs in the honeymoon suite of a hotel (yup, the only one available) while Sophia lies in the hospital. They express their deep concern over Sophia through sex and also consider partaking in the room's available champagne and hot tub. Never addressed is the fact they left Sophia in the hospital overnight alone! Also not addressed is the fact that Chloe was responsible for the accident by accepting a ride in a stranger's car and not properly restraining Sophia. I'm not even a parent, and that bothered me!
The book features a few Big Misunderstandings, quick forgiveness, a couple of Big Twists (that actually surprised me), and two minor villains. The author attempted to wrap everything up with a bow in a manner that would test even the most tolerant reader's credulity.
*** End spoilers ***
My review probably sounds like it should be no more than 2 stars. I'm trying to be fair with the 3, because the author's writing itself is not bad, and some people might actually enjoy this book. I happened to dislike the lead characters, and that feeling was intensified because I felt that the author glossed over or ignored some pretty horrible behavior and expected us to like the characters as soon as she waved her magic wand.
I just wish there were more books about men who are kind, self-confident, compassionate, and yes, SEXY, with amazing techniques in bed. Is a man like this really less appealing to readers than a man like Gaelan? Obviously, there's a big appeal for the Gaelan types, based on the amount of books I see.

Cliched but the author shows promise
By J's mom
Caution! This review contains spoilers!
The Billionaire's Secrets has a wonderful premise with great mood and setting. I was pleasantly surprised to see it was set in Newfoundland, a rare place to set a romantic suspense. I also felt that the writing was clean and the very few mistakes I found weren't bothersome, with the exception that I always thought that the rum, Screech, was a brand name, yet it was never capitalized. But what really bothered me was although the novel had been revised in 2012, the same issues remained in the new copy. The hero gets mad at heroine, then kisses her, then she gets mad and forgives him. Then the cycle starts again in a different scene. The hero appeared to have a bipolar disorder.
The plot was cliched and unbelievable. In the opening scene, the heroine is nearly run over by the hero who then drives off after telling her that if she can walk to his home, with all her luggage, she has the job. The hero is difficult to like and the heroine, though strong, is too forgiving, mostly because the hero is handsome and the child she is to educate is too cute. I also felt that the scene in the hotel was staged as if the author was trying to install the requisite love scene. It was hard to believe that in the city there was only one hotel room available and it was the honeymoon suite, and that the hospital would not allow a parent to stay with an injured child. The characters did not endear themselves by wanting to make love and open a bottle of champagne to celebrate that the child was not injured too badly.
When the lovemaking is finally consummated several scenes later, a spare bedroom magically appears beside his home office and the pair can make love there. The plot twists at the end of the book were more than predictable and the unlikeable hero switched too suddenly. The author has talent, but should employ a brutal editor to point out plot problems in her future stories. She tried too hard to recreate a Jane Eyre styled book at the expense of believability. Jane Eyre is a book that reflected the times in which it was set. It does not translate well in today's world.
But there is enough quality writing in this book to warrant saying that if the author publishes another book, I might try her again.
